Реализовать поля на рабочем листе
Введение
Когда дело доходит до создания электронных таблиц, которые не только хорошо выглядят, но и функционируют без сбоев, обеспечение правильных полей является ключевым фактором. Поля на рабочем листе могут существенно повлиять на то, как данные представляются при печати или экспорте, что приводит к более профессиональному виду. В этом уроке мы разберем, как реализовать поля на рабочем листе Excel с помощью Aspose.Cells для .NET. Если вы когда-либо испытывали трудности с форматированием в Excel, оставайтесь здесь — я обещаю, что это проще, чем кажется!
Предпосылки
Прежде чем углубиться в детали, давайте убедимся, что у вас есть все необходимое для начала работы:
- Среда .NET: Убедитесь, что у вас настроена соответствующая среда разработки .NET. Вы можете использовать Visual Studio или любую другую IDE, которая поддерживает разработку .NET.
- Библиотека Aspose.Cells: Вам нужно будет загрузить библиотеку Aspose.Cells for .NET. Не волнуйтесь, вы можете взять ее с сайт .
- Базовое понимание C#: Базовые знания C# будут очень полезны. Если вы знакомы с объектно-ориентированным программированием, вы уже на полпути!
- Доступ к каталогу документов: создайте каталог в вашей системе, где вы можете сохранять свои файлы. Это пригодится при запуске программы. Имея в своем арсенале эти необходимые инструменты, давайте рассмотрим, как устанавливать поля с помощью Aspose.Cells для .NET.
Импортные пакеты
Прежде чем начать кодирование, нам нужно импортировать необходимые пакеты. В C# это простая задача. Вы начнете свой скрипт с директивы using, чтобы добавить требуемые классы из библиотеки Aspose.Cells. Вот как это сделать:
using System.IO;
using Aspose.Cells;
using System;
Теперь, когда мы импортировали необходимый пакет, мы можем перейти к пошаговому процессу настройки полей.
Шаг 1: Определите каталог документов
Первый шаг — указать путь, где вы будете хранить свои файлы. Думайте об этом как о настройке рабочего пространства, где будут происходить все ваши действия, связанные с документами.
string dataDir = "Your Document Directory";
Заменять"Your Document Directory"
с реальным путем. Это говорит вашей программе, где искать и сохранять файлы.
Шаг 2: Создание объекта рабочей книги
Далее мы создадим объект Workbook. По сути, это основа любого файла Excel, с которым вы будете работать.
Workbook workbook = new Workbook();
Эта строка инициализирует новый экземпляр Workbook, которым вы будете управлять, чтобы настроить рабочий лист и его поля.
Шаг 3: Доступ к коллекции рабочих листов
Теперь давайте получим доступ к коллекции рабочих листов в вашей недавно созданной рабочей книге.
WorksheetCollection worksheets = workbook.Worksheets;
Эта строка позволяет управлять и манипулировать несколькими рабочими листами в рабочей книге.
Шаг 4: Выберите рабочий лист по умолчанию
Далее вам нужно будет поработать с первым (стандартным) рабочим листом.
Worksheet worksheet = worksheets[0];
Индексируяworksheets[0]
, вы извлекаете первый лист, на котором вы установите поля.
Шаг 5: Получите объект PageSetup
На каждом рабочем листе есть объект PageSetup, который позволяет настраивать параметры, относящиеся к макету страницы, включая поля.
PageSetup pageSetup = worksheet.PageSetup;
На этом этапе фактически подготавливаются необходимые настройки для рабочего листа, чтобы вы могли теперь настроить поля.
Шаг 6: Установите поля
Имея объект PageSetup на руках, теперь вы можете задать поля.
pageSetup.BottomMargin = 2;
pageSetup.LeftMargin = 1;
pageSetup.RightMargin = 1;
pageSetup.TopMargin = 3;
Вот где происходит волшебство! Вы определяете поля в дюймах (или других единицах измерения, в зависимости от ваших настроек). Не стесняйтесь корректировать эти значения в соответствии с вашими требованиями.
Шаг 7: Сохраните рабочую книгу
Последний шаг — сохранение вашей рабочей книги. Это зафиксирует все внесенные вами изменения, включая эти шикарные поля!
workbook.Save(dataDir + "SetMargins_out.xls");
Просто не забудьте заменитьdataDir
с вашим реальным путем к каталогу. Вы можете назвать свой файл Excel как угодно —SetMargins_out.xls
это просто заполнитель.
Заключение
И вот оно! Вы успешно включили поля в лист Excel с помощью Aspose.Cells для .NET всего за несколько простых шагов. Прелесть использования Aspose.Cells заключается в его эффективности и простоте. Независимо от того, форматируете ли вы профессиональный отчет, научную работу или просто поддерживаете четкость своих личных проектов, управление полями — это просто.
Часто задаваемые вопросы
Что такое Aspose.Cells?
Aspose.Cells — мощная библиотека, предназначенная для создания, изменения и управления файлами Excel в приложениях .NET.
Могу ли я использовать Aspose.Cells бесплатно?
Да, Aspose предлагает бесплатная пробная версия который позволяет вам изучить возможности библиотеки.
Как получить поддержку по Aspose.Cells?
Вы можете найти поддержку на форуме Aspose, посвященном Aspose.Cells .
Можно ли форматировать другие аспекты рабочего листа?
Конечно! Aspose.Cells предоставляет обширные возможности форматирования помимо полей, включая шрифты, цвета и границы.
Как приобрести лицензию на Aspose.Cells?
Вы можете купить лицензию напрямую у Страница покупки Aspose .